Bladder cancer is the 10th most prevalent cancer globally, affecting millions of people, particularly the aging population. The incidence rate is particularly high in North America and Europe, with a strong correlation to environmental factors such as smoking and exposure to industrial chemicals.

Key Market Drivers

1. Rising Incidence of Bladder Cancer The growing incidence of bladder cancer is a significant driver of market growth. According to the American Cancer Society, bladder cancer cases have increased due to aging populations and rising environmental risk factors. Smoking, a leading cause of bladder cancer, continues to fuel the increase in bladder cancer diagnoses globally.

3. Increased R&D Investments The bladder cancer treatment market is witnessing substantial R&D investments, primarily driven by pharmaceutical companies aiming to introduce novel therapies. The focus is on expanding the use of checkpoint inhibitors, developing next-generation targeted therapies, and conducting trials for innovative gene therapies. Investments are also flowing into improving diagnostic tools, such as liquid biopsies, which allow for less invasive monitoring of cancer progression.

4. Growing Demand for Minimally Invasive Treatments The demand for minimally invasive treatments, such as laparoscopic and robotic-assisted surgeries, is growing. These methods offer faster recovery times and reduced post-surgical complications, making them attractive options for patients. Furthermore, advancements in radiotherapy, including proton therapy, are allowing more precise targeting of tumors with fewer side effects.

Market Challenges

1. High Treatment Costs The rising cost of bladder cancer treatments, particularly immunotherapies and targeted therapies, presents a significant challenge for healthcare systems and patients. For instance, checkpoint inhibitors like pembrolizumab can cost tens of thousands of dollars per treatment cycle. This financial burden is particularly challenging for uninsured or underinsured patients in low- and middle-income countries.

2. Side Effects and Long-Term Complications While newer therapies have improved survival rates, many come with severe side effects. Immunotherapies, for example, can cause immune-related adverse events, including inflammation of the lungs (pneumonitis), liver (hepatitis), and skin (dermatitis). Similarly, chemotherapy and radiotherapy can cause long-term damage to the bladder and surrounding organs, complicating post-treatment quality of life.

3. Regulatory Barriers and Approvals The process of bringing new bladder cancer treatments to market is lengthy and complex, with stringent requirements from regulatory agencies like the U.S. FDA and the European Medicines Agency (EMA). These bodies demand extensive clinical trial data to prove the safety and efficacy of new drugs, which can delay market entry and increase R&D costs.

Emerging Trends and Innovations

1. Immunotherapy’s Growing Influence Immunotherapy is revolutionizing bladder cancer treatment, with immune checkpoint inhibitors showing promising results in advanced-stage cancer patients. Drugs such as nivolumab (Opdivo) and atezolizumab (Tecentriq) have gained FDA approval for use in patients who have not responded to chemotherapy. The success of immunotherapies in bladder cancer is expected to grow further as more checkpoint inhibitors are approved and new combination therapies are developed.

2. Personalized Medicine The shift towards personalized medicine is one of the most significant trends in the bladder cancer treatment market. By identifying specific genetic mutations in tumors, doctors can tailor treatment options that are more likely to be effective for individual patients. For instance, drugs that target FGFR mutations are providing new avenues for patients whose cancer doesn’t respond to traditional therapies.

3. Artificial Intelligence and Machine Learning in Diagnostics AI and machine learning are increasingly being applied in cancer diagnostics. AI can analyze large datasets from medical imaging and genetic testing, helping to identify cancer earlier and predict treatment outcomes. These technologies are also being used to optimize treatment protocols and develop predictive models for patient survival.
